Output e5136431240cf53e4a61cd1bb8089ed81b8e69d34bca020cb239567d8ab471c4:3

value
76083740
script pubkey
OP_0 OP_PUSHBYTES_20 5f57c00b1091848504c10d19b2ea2c2e27409eac
address
ltc1qtatuqzcsjxzg2pxpp5vm963v9cn5p84vja7sd9
transaction
e5136431240cf53e4a61cd1bb8089ed81b8e69d34bca020cb239567d8ab471c4
spent
true